This Sandwich ELISA kit is an in vitro enzyme-linked immunosorbent assay for the measurement of human Cleaved-Caspase-3 and Caspase-3. An anti-Caspase-3 antibody has been coated onto a 96-well plate. Samples are pipetted into the wells and Caspase-3 present in a sample is bound to the wells by the immobilized antibody. The wells are washed and rabbit anti-Cleaved-Caspase-3 (Asp175) antibody is used to detect Cleaved Caspase-3 or mouse anti-Caspase-3 antibody is used to detect Caspase-3. After washing away unbound antibody, HRP-conjugated anti-rabbit IgG or HRP-conjugated anti-mouse IgG is pipetted to the wells. The wells are again washed, a TMB substrate solution is added to the wells and color develops in proportion to the amount of Cleaved Caspase-3 (Asp175) or Caspase-3 bound. The Stop Solution changes the color from blue to yellow, and the intensity of the color is measured at 450 nm.

Protocol Outline
  1. Prepare all reagents and samples as instructed in the manual.
  2. Add 100 µl of sample or positive control to each well.
  3. Incubate 2.5 h at RT or O/N at 4 °C.
  4. Add 100 µl of prepared primary antibody to each well.
  5. Incubate 1 h at RT.
  6. Add 100 µl of prepared 1X HRP-Streptavidin to each well.
  7. Incubate 1 h at RT.
  8. Add 100 µl of TMB One-Step Substrate Reagent to each well.
  9. Incubate 30 min at RT.
  10. Add 50 µl of Stop Solution to each well.
  11. Read at 450 nm immediately.

Storage/Stability

Upon receipt, the kit should be stored at –20°C. Please use within 6 months from the date of shipment. After initial use, Wash Buffer Concentrate (Item B), Assay Diluent (Item E), TMB One-Step Substrate Reagent (Item H), Stop Solution (Item I) and Cell Lysate Buffer (Item J) should be stored at 4°C to avoid repeated freeze-thaw cycles. Return unused wells to the pouch containing desiccant pack, reseal along entire edge, and store at –20°C. Item D, store at 2-8°C for up to one month (store at -20°C for up to 6 months, avoid repeated freeze-thaw cycles). Reconstituted Positive Control (Item K) should be stored at -70°C.
